Yoshimichi Namai is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Yoshimichi Namai has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 688 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Materials Chemistry, 9 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 3 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Yoshimichi Namai’s work include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(7 papers),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(7 papers) and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(6 papers). Yoshimichi Namai is often cited by papers focused on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(7 papers),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(7 papers) and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(6 papers). Yoshimichi Namai collaborates with scholars based in Japan and Germany. Yoshimichi Namai's co-authors include Yasuhiro Iwasawa, Kenichi Fukui, Hitoshi Shindo, Ryugo Tero and Takehiko Sasaki and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Physical Chemistry B, Physical Chemistry Chemical Physics and Catalysis Today.
